1. What Are Cookies?
Cookies are small text files stored on your device (computer, smartphone, or tablet) when you visit a website. They help websites function, improve your experience, and provide useful information to the website owner.
Cookies can be:
• Session cookies – deleted when you close your browser.
• Persistent cookies – stored for a defined period or until manually deleted.
• First-party cookies – set by our website.
• Third-party cookies – set by services we use (e.g., Google, Facebook).
